  • Origami Bag Tutorial - The Origami Bag (also known as the Origami Market Tote Bag or azuma bukuro) is a nice simple diy tote bag that would suit a beginner. You could make this with just one piece of fabric but we like having a lining, hence why we are using two pieces. We've also boxed the corners but you can choose not to do that if you wish. This is a nice easy sewing project for beginners.

      Don't watch the needle as you sew...instead watch the fabric as it feeds keeping it straight against the seam allowance marks on the face plate...I sew every day making market bags with a lot of top stitching. I've extended the measuring lines on my machine with marker and a straight edge so I've got an even better line to guide my fabric against. Blue painter's tape is another trick I use when top stitching away from the fabric edge. I place it then stitch alongside it. Just some thoughts...hard to explain this stuff without a visual.
